John Form has found the perfect gift for his expectant wife, Mia - a beautiful, rare vintage doll in a pure white wedding dress. On one horrific night, their home is invaded by members of a satanic cult, who violently attack the couple. Spilled blood and terror are not all they leave behind. The cultists have conjured an entity so malevolent that nothing they did will compare to the sinister conduit to the damned that is now… Annabelle. This one has a lot of good moments, but it just didn’t have the same impact that the Conjuring did. They do some interesting things with it, including the less is more guide to horror and dread film-making, but it just didn’t have quite the same impact.
